Wrong - if the cruise starts and ends in EU ports and does not go outside the EU then you will cop VAT all the time. Spain charges 8% on drinks etc. so BCN to BCN has 8% VAT.
Italy zero-rates drinks so with Rome/Venice starts and finishes you do not get VAT on drinks. (No duty-free purchases though)

The attachment states 'France (including Monaco)'.
We did the same trip (Jade BCN - BCN) and paid 8% all the time.
Last summer we did a Jade B2B out of Venice - first week we visited Croatia and Turkey so no VAT and duty-free sales. Second week was Greek islands so VAT 'charged' (at 0%) and no duty-free.
